A man manipulates cannabis seeds at a lab in Santiago, on October 29, 2014. Chile authorized for the first time to plant 850 cannabis seeds for medicinal use. This first stage aims to treat some 200 cancer patients with some of the components of the plant, phytocannabinoids such as THC and CBD.
